That car is not really a police car; the D.A.R.E. logo means it's the Drug Abuse Resistence Education program. They've slapped that logo on several cars that are siezed and auctioned from drug trafficers.

In this case, this particular Supra is doing the rounds at Broward County schools, parks, etc. I've never seen that particular car, although they've had Camaros and Mustangs in the past (which resembled cop cars, but aren't...although they've made do double-takes on my speedometer before).
